Practices that may help
- Shift your schedule toward your chronotype gradually
Move workday bed and wake times by fifteen minutes every few days toward your natural preference.
Sleep Debt and Social Jetlag: Recovery Strategies - Go to bed only when sleepy, not just tired
Learn to distinguish genuine sleepiness from tiredness and wait for the former before going to bed.
Stimulus Control for Sleep - Evening yoga routine for sleep
A gentle 15-minute yoga sequence 30–60 minutes before bed lowers cortisol and core temperature to accelerate sleep onset.
Yoga for Stress: What the Research Shows - Use your temperature minimum to time light, exercise, and meals
Your body temperature hits a daily low about 2 hours before your average wake time — knowing it lets you shift your clock deliberately.
Morning Light Anchoring - Use 4-7-8 breathing as a sleep-onset ritual
Four to eight cycles in bed before sleep reduces physiological arousal and supports the transition into sleep.
4-7-8 Breathing, Made Practical - Avoid bright overhead light in the 2 hours before bed
Bright light after ~9 pm suppresses melatonin and shifts your clock later — dim the environment instead.
Morning Light Anchoring - Dim light in the evening
Lower light intensity in the last hours before bed so the clock can wind down.
Circadian Rhythm Optimization - Beat the snooze (the wake-up application)
Count 5-4-3-2-1 and put your feet on the floor before the snooze argument starts.
The 5 Second Rule, Made Practical - Align your sleep window with the circadian gate
Go to bed when both systems are aligned: sleep pressure is high AND the clock is in its sleep phase.
The Two-Process Model of Sleep - Get bright light early in the day
Get outside daylight in the first hour or two after waking to set your clock.
